Self-emptying

A self-emptying robot vacuum can help you save time and effort in cleaning. Its docking station holds large storage bags that is full and can be taken off and replaced. This eliminates the need to empty a tiny dustbin on the robot vacuum cleaners reviews itself and it can reduce health risks and hygiene issues in the presence of dust and hair of pets. It also stops the bin from becoming full, which can lead to an absence of vacuum and even spitting debris into the living area.

A vacuum that is able to be used to empty the vacuum automatically is worth considering if you have family members suffering from allergies or hay fever to prevent the introduction of dirt back into your home. Additionally, it's a great choice for those with a busy schedule who are looking to reduce the amount of time they spend cleaning their home.

Most robot vacuums can be operated by a mobile application and voice commands. You can turn them on the machine, stop it or return them back to their dock. Some can even tell you when they're tangled up with a broken piece of furniture or their battery is empty.

The higher-end models scan their environment using cameras and laser sensors, which enables them to determine the most efficient way to go before entering each room. This will help them avoid being tripped by furniture or stranded on stray cable.

Most modern robot cleaners are able to create detailed maps of your home that can be accessed through the app. It is common to save multiple maps, and you may also be able to add "exclusion zones" that the cleaner will not enter. Advanced cleaners with mopping capabilities allow you to define areas for Best Robot Vacuum Cleaner UK cleaning and add specific pieces of furniture to the map to ensure they get cleaned.

Obstacle avoidance

Robots can avoid clutter and debris by using object avoidance technology. It stops them from spilling anything that could block or damage internal components and saves you the trouble of having to remove obstructions from their suction or out of under furniture. A lot of the latest models, such as smart home appliances as well as robot vacuum best vacuums, are equipped with high-tech obstacles avoidance technology that can operate in real-time.

When looking for the top robotic vacuums, select those with advanced obstacle detection technology. They can operate in various lighting conditions and recognize various objects. The top smart robots use multiple sensors to provide an enhanced understanding of their surroundings, and they're able to avoid obstacles even when the layout of the room changes. Some examples of advanced technology for avoiding obstacles include crossed IR sensor and 3D structured lighting and ToF sensors (time of flight).

Crossed IR sensors emit focused beams of infrared light which reflect off objects and help the robot detect them. This kind sensor is commonly used in robot vacuums and other cleaning robots, and is particularly efficient in dark rooms. Some of the more expensive models come with 3D structured lights, which emit light pulses in a pattern that are distorted by the objects in the room. 3D structured light is often combined with cameras and crossed IR sensors to provide an even more comprehensive obstacle-avoiding system.

Cameras are another technology that is used for robot vacuums and mopping bots. They are bi-cular or monocular, and can take pictures and then process them to detect obstacles. The top robotic hoovers vacuums that have camera sensors provide the most comprehensive obstacle-avoiding solution and can be paired with other technologies to produce better results.

One of the most advanced obstacle avoidance systems is offered by IRobot's Roomba J7+. The model has an inbuilt video camera that can recognize objects of various sizes, including pet waste. iRobot's confidence in this technology is so steadfast that it provides a "Pet Poop Promise" guarantee: if the robot is able to detect pet waste the company will repair the device at no cost to the customer.

Cleaning

The best robot vacuums use a combination sensors and lasers to map the area that they are cleaning. This allows them to plan their route and avoid hitting furniture and stairs as well as other obstacles. They can also decide the need for a specific area to be cleaned again and then return to their dock if their power is low or their bins are full.

You can connect your robot vacuum to your smart assistant such as Alexa, Google Home or Siri and control it through the app on your smartphone. This is particularly helpful in situations where you're not at home and want to schedule an easy clean or begin an extensive cleaning. Many models will also allow you to manually trigger an automatic clean using the app, if you're looking to tackle spills or stains.

Although robot vacuums are the most common type of robotic cleaner there are ones that mop too. They are typically available as separate robot mops or hybrid versions that include mop attachments. Traditional robot mop plates are ones that attach on the back or underside of the vacuum, with small water tanks and mop pads. They are great for quick shine on freshly vacuumed floors, but they aren't able to remove a sticky stain such as the ketchup stain.

Modern robot mops have tanks that are built-in to them and are designed to mop as they go. These mops are ideal for stains that are difficult to remove, but they can take longer to clean a room. Certain models also automatically return to their docks and refill their tanks when they're full, which can be useful if you suffer from hay fever or allergies.
